Merge tag 'xtensa-next-20130508' of git://github.com/czankel/xtensa-linux
Pull xtensa updates from Chris Zankel:
"Support for the latest MMU architecture that allows for a larger
accessible memory region, and various bug-fixes"
* tag 'xtensa-next-20130508' of git://github.com/czankel/xtensa-linux:
xtensa: Switch to asm-generic/linkage.h
xtensa: fix redboot load address
xtensa: ISS: fix timer_lock usage in rs_open
xtensa: disable IRQs while IRQ handler is running
xtensa: enable lockdep support
xtensa: fix arch_irqs_disabled_flags implementation
xtensa: add irq flags trace support
xtensa: provide custom CALLER_ADDR* implementations
xtensa: add stacktrace support
xtensa: clean up stpill_registers
xtensa: don't use a7 in simcalls
xtensa: don't attempt to use unconfigured timers
xtensa: provide default platform_pcibios_init implementation
xtensa: remove KCORE_ELF again
xtensa: document MMUv3 setup sequence
xtensa: add MMU v3 support
xtensa: fix ibreakenable register update
xtensa: fix oprofile building as module
